Pennsylvania's climate, characterized by distinct seasons, directly impacts air duct cleanliness. During the humid summer months, moisture can contribute to mold and mildew growth within ducts, while winter heating cycles blow dry, dusty air. Older housing stock common in many Pennsylvania communities, especially those built before the 1980s, may have less efficient duct sealing, leading to greater air leakage and pollutant infiltration. This makes regular duct cleaning a practical step for maintaining indoor air quality throughout the year, particularly in the Philadelphia metro area where urban density can also influence air pollutant levels.

What are the signs air ducts need cleaning?

Visible dust buildup around vents, a noticeable increase in dust in your home, or a persistent musty odor when the HVAC system runs are common indicators. If you experience new or worsening allergy symptoms, especially when the system is on, your air ducts may require attention. These signs are prevalent in areas like Philadelphia.

Can I clean my AC ducts myself?

While some superficial cleaning of vent covers is possible, a thorough air duct cleaning requires specialized equipment and expertise. Professional technicians use powerful vacuums and brushes to remove debris from deep within the ductwork. Attempting to clean them yourself can push dust further in or damage the ducts.

What time of year is best for duct cleaning?

The best time for duct cleaning in Pennsylvania is generally during the spring or fall. These seasons offer milder weather, reducing the strain on your HVAC system and allowing for easier scheduling. Cleaning before or after peak heating and cooling usage helps ensure optimal performance.
